We are migrating assets in the middle of fiscal year.
After migration , Do we need to run AFAB from period 1 or just need to run for current period?
Thanks
Hi,
It depends on the setting in 'Period in which depreciation was posted' part of fixed asset migration customizing. If the input is last period then depreciation run for current period. On the other hand, if the input is period 12 of prior year then depreciation run from period 01 may be required.

Hi, it's me again.
That scenario can happen when there isn't any depreciation run in current fiscal year and usually is the case in quality system because it is not required to execute depreciation process every month.
The suggestion is to execute depreciation run from period 01 up to 05 in the test system, then do legacy asset data upload > after that perform depreciation run for current period.
